Antigenic variants of leptospiras selected by antiserum-complement mediated-killing.

The presence of antigenic variants of leptospiras was confirmed by the leptospiricidal reaction mediated by the antiserum plus complement. More than 99% of the organisms of virulent L. copenhageni Shibaura were destroyed microscopically after treatment with the anti-L. copenhageni Shibaura antiserum (1: 2000) plus guinea pig complement (1: 20). The leptospiras which survived treatment with the antiserum plus complement produced colonies on the solid serum medium at a rate of 0.09%. Eighty-seven percent of the survivors were found to be antigenic variants. The antigenicity of these variants reversed to that of the parent after 3--5 passages in the liquid normal serum medium.
